前端

异步更新的艺术:从Vue nextTick到现代前端异步调度全景解析

📋 摘要本文深度解析Vue.js中nextTick机制的核心原理与使用场景,并横向对比React、Angular、Svelte等主流框架的异步更新策略。文章不仅涵盖传统DOM更新优化,更结合AI驱动的前端智能化、微前端架构、Serverless渲染等前沿技术,探讨异步调度在现代Web开发中的演进方向。通过理论分析、实战案例与可视化图表&#

【前端】Vue3+elementui+ts,给标签设置样式属性style时,提示type check failed for prop,再次请出DeepSeek来解答

🌹欢迎来到《小5讲堂》🌹 🌹这是《前端》系列文章,每篇文章将以博主理解的角度展开讲解。🌹 🌹温馨提示:博主能力有限,理解水平有限,若有不对之处望指正!🌹 目录 前言 警告信息 DeepSeek解答 问题原因 解

uni-app 根据用户不同身份显示不同的tabBar

最近在一个uni-app项目中遇到一个需求,在登录页面成功登录以后需要判断身份,不同的身份的进入不同的tabBar页面,但是在uni-app项目中pages.json中的tabBar的list数组只有一个,且不能写成动态的,那如何实现这个需求呢?答案是需要我们自定义tabBar。 1、我们确定在 pages.json文件中的pages数组中的第一个页面就是进入程序时展示的第一个页面,那这个页面

前端国际化之i18n(VUE项目)

解释与说明        i18n,全名是internationalization,称为国际化。        我理解的就四个字:语言转换。        让以其他语言作为母语的人能看懂你的前端中的文字。        我们常用的就是中文简体(zh_CN)与英文(美国)(en_US&#x

Pinia的简单使用

1.什么是Pinia? 1.pinia 和 vuex 具有相同的功效, 是 Vue 的存储库,它允许您跨组件/页面共享状态。 2.设计使用的是 Composition api,更符合vue3的设计思维。 3.Pinia 对 Vue 2 和 Vue 3 都有效,并且不需要您使用组合 API。 2.Pinia 的使用 2.1 Pinia 的安装 在安装Pinia的时候可以使用yarn 也可以使用 np

WebRTC C++底层开发实战指南

本文还有配套的精品资源,点击获取 简介:WebRTC是一项支持浏览器实时通信的开放技术,广泛应用于视频会议、在线教育等领域。本教程专注于WebRTC的C++层面开发,深入讲解其底层架构与核心组件,包括PeerConnection、ICE、STUN/TURN、SDP、DTLS、DataChannels等。

前端已死?5分钟,我用Claude 3.7 Sonnet复刻了10款童年经典小游戏!

用代码复刻10款童年经典小游戏,包括:五子棋、2048、贪吃蛇、打地鼠、飞机大战等等,需要多长时间?Claude 3.7 Sonnet 给出的答案是:5分钟。每个游戏30秒生成时间,足以。不仅仅是功能满足要求,还兼具一定的美观性,此外,10个游戏均为响应式设计&#xff0c

OpenClaw dashboard命令后,无法登录web控制面板(在systemd服务无法启动的一些虚拟机里会碰到)

先上结论执行OpenClaw dashboard命令后,无法登录web控制面板,是因为OpenClaw的gateway服务没有起来。原来小龙虾OpenClaw 的命令没有学明白,先弄清楚命令:openclaw onboard 是配置openclaw dashboard是显示web控制面板登录信息openclaw gateway --verbo

基于物理引导和不确定性量化的轻量化神经网络机械退化预测算法(Python)

算法正在完善中算法正在完善中核心是通过融合物理模型和深度学习进行机械退化轨迹预测和不确定性量化。首先对原始振动信号提取时频域特征,与运行时间、温度等物理变量共同构成输入向量;然后加载预训练的多架构神经网络模型(包括CFC、LTC、TCN、LSTM等),这些模型均集成了物理退化方程的约束项;接着在不同工况&#xff0

Kotlin中,理解T.()->Unit 、 ()->Unit与(T) -> Unit

Kotlin比Java更方便的地方,其中之一是可以将函数作为参数。 上面三者都是将函数作为其它函数的参数来使用,其形式虽然简单,但理解并不简单。 一、共同点 三者的返回值相同,均为Unit,即没有返回值。 当然有返回值也可以,比如返回一个泛型R,或者是一个具体的值Int等 如: T.()->R、 ()->R、(T) -> R 或者: T.()->Int、 ()->In